Job Description
About the Team
The Business and Strategy Analytics team is part of the Intelligence and Data Solutions team, partnering with the Asia Pacific Regional President’s Office to enable Visa internal business units to optimize performance and profitability and make data-driven decisions. The successful candidate will focus on driving value from Visa’s unique data assets to strengthen and extend Visa’s impact in the payments landscape for the Japan market. Based in Tokyo, Japan, this role requires strong business acumen and analytical skills to deliver data science projects that solve Visa’s business objectives.
What an Data Science Senior Manager does at Visa:
The successful candidate will focus on driving value from Visa’ unique data assets to strengthen and extend Visa’s impact in the payments landscape for Japan market. You will be required to use your business acumen along with analytical skillset to deliver data science projects that solve Visa’s business objectives. Based on findings from data-driven analysis, you will draw fact-based insights and make actionable recommendations that reflect the business and context. You will be required to work with large data sets using quantitative techniques and build complex statistical models that learn from big data and provide data visualization to enable business stakeholders consume the information. Data sets will include, but not limited to, Visa Net transaction data, Visa operational data, and relevant third party data sources. We have a highly collaborative process and you are required to work across multiple teams and functions for leading & developing cutting edge, creative and advanced analytic solutions.
The role reports to Management Intelligence Lead within the AP Business and Strategy Analytics team, and also the Head of Japan Strategy, Business Planning & Operations, and will be based in Tokyo.
